Transaction d9105a63b6cca4f842d2031d564ea931e90284a6887c413ec6625e4bed32148a
1 Input
1 Output
-
d9105a63b6cca4f842d2031d564ea931e90284a6887c413ec6625e4bed32148a:0
- value
- 6511790
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1d5bb42369f2b64922f02a4c005d7d56b23ebb7
- address
- bc1qu82mks3knu4kfy30q2jvqpwh644j86ahlfsacp